Description Lyall Pearce 2011-12-08 08:25:49 UTC
Installation of KDE is easy, emerge kde-meta, however, not everyone wants everything that kde-meta includes.

I would like to propose that the kde-meta include a few USE flags, such as 'education', 'scientific' and particularly 'games', such that, setting of use flags will not install unwanted apps.

The alternative is to unmerge kde-meta and manually install each required sub meta package, exlcluding the unwanted meta packages.
Comment 1 Vladimir Varlamov 2011-12-08 09:15:11 UTC
You should try to make a minimum use-flags. Therefore this is not an alternative but the expected behavior.
Comment 2 Johannes Huber (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2011-12-08 10:45:51 UTC
Please read description of kde-base/kde-meta. If you want a modular kde start with kde-base/kdebase-meta and add applications or other meta packages afterwards. For more information see:
